HBM, or High Bandwidth Memory, is a type of high-performance memory technology designed to address the growing demand for faster data transfer rates and lower power consumption in modern computing systems, particularly for GPUs and accelerators. HBM is widely used in applications like AI, machine learning, high-performance computing (HPC), and graphics rendering

RDIMM (Registered Dual In-Line Memory Module) is a type of memory module commonly used in servers and workstations to improve memory stability, capacity, and performance. It incorporates a register (or buffer) between the memory controller and the DRAM chips, which helps manage electrical load and improve reliability in systems with large amounts of RAM.

Enterprise SSDs (Solid State Drives) are high-performance storage devices designed for use in data centers, servers, and enterprise environments. They are built to handle demanding workloads, provide high reliability, and ensure consistent performance under heavy usage. 2.5-inch: Common for enterprise servers. U.2: High-performance NVMe SSDs. M.2: Compact form factor for space-constrained environments. PCIe Add-in Cards (AIC): Directly connected to the PCIe bus for maximum performance. SATA: Common for entry-level enterprise SSDs. NVMe (Non-Volatile Memory Express): High-speed interface for ultra-low latency and maximum performance. SAS (Serial Attached SCSI): High-performance interface for enterprise environments.
